The 10 Most Popular Golf Videos on YouTube in June

Top 10 Golf Videos This Month: Let’s Dive into the Fun!

Hey there, golf enthusiasts and YouTube addicts! If you’ve been scrolling through your feed, you might have noticed that the buzz this month is all about some familiar faces (and some seriously entertaining content). Bryson DeChambeau is dominating the charts again, racking up those top spots. We’ve got Grant Horvat hanging out with the Bryan Brothers, and Bob from Bob Does Sports made a sneaky appearance. June is serving up a delightful medley of pressure tests at Oakmont, a zany match with Tommy Fleetwood, and all the delightful chaos our favorite YouTube golf creators are known for. So, grab your snacks and get comfy because we’re diving into the top 10 golf videos you absolutely can’t miss this month!

1. The World’s Hardest Golf Course: Oakmont Country Club

Channel: Bryson DeChambeau
Views: 3.7 million

First up, we’ve got Bryson DeChambeau taking on the beast known as Oakmont Country Club. This course is so tough it’s where the Stimpmeter was born! With 175 bunkers, deep roughs, and greens that can send your ball rolling back to your feet, Oakmont is not for the faint of heart.

In this epic video, Bryson walks you through the course and shares his memories of finishing T-16 there in 2016. Trust me, if you’re itching to see some serious championship prep in action, this is your go-to watch!

2. Can I Break a Public Course Record in One Try? (Water Everywhere)

Channel: Bryson DeChambeau
Views: 2.8 million

Next up, we’re back with Bryson! This time he’s at Waterchase Golf Club in Texas, a course everyone raves about. He’s on a mission to break the course record of 64. These "record-breaking" challenges are always entertaining, filled with Bryson’s signature long drives, clutch putts, and of course, those protein bars.

If you love watching someone chase a record while having a blast, this one’s a must-see!

3. The YouTube Golf Major (Stroke Play)

Channel: Grant Horvat
Views: 2 million

Jumping over to Grant Horvat, he’s hosting the YouTube Golf Major at the stunning Black Desert Resort in Utah. It’s a handicapped stroke-play showdown where every shot counts. Picture this: tons of trash talk and leaderboard flips, making it part comedy, part nail-biting golf match.

You don’t want to miss how these creators bring their A-game and a lot of laughs!

4. The Major Cut @ Oakmont (U.S. Open)

Channel: Grant Horvat Golf
Views: 1.9 million

Back to Oakmont! This time, Grant, along with Wesley and George Bryan, is tackling the Major Cut challenge. Their goal? Survive two grueling rounds without surpassing +6. With tight fairways and fast greens, the pressure is palpable. Expect some great moments, intense competition, and a few nail-biting challenges.

If you like high stakes golf, this is your jam!

5. Our First Ever 18-Hole Drinking Challenge!

Channel: Bob Does Sports
Views: 1.5 million

Get ready for some fun! The Bob Does Sports crew decided to embark on an 18-hole drinking challenge. Each player starts with 18 drinks, and every birdie they score removes one, while each bogey adds one. Watching these guys balance drinking and playing is as entertaining as it gets!

This video is perfect if you’re looking for something light-hearted and full of laughs!

6. We Had a $250,000 Golf Match! (The Duels Virginia)

Channel: Bryan Bros Golf
Views: 1.4 million

Five amazing YouTube creators teamed up with some major champions like Phil Mickelson and Sergio Garcia for a $250K scramble showdown. Expect elite golf skills mixed with a bit of organized chaos that only these guys can deliver.

If you’re a fan of high-level golf coupled with a fun atmosphere, you’ll definitely want to tune into this one!

7. The Funniest Video We’ve Ever Made (Bob Does Sports X Grant Horvat X Bryan Bros)

Channel: Bob Does Sports
Views: 1.4 million

At Cascata Golf Club, the hilarious Bob Does Sports crew teams up with Grant and the Bryans for a unique match. It’s a blend of alternate-shot and scramble format, offering plenty of comic relief. From ridiculous shots to unexpected laughs, it’s an entertaining twist on competitive golf.

This one’s all about fun and friendly competition. You won’t want to miss it!

8. Big Wedge $100 Versus $10,000 Golf Clubs!

Channel: Big Wedge Golf
Views: 1.4 million

Big Wes is back with a challenge that puts equipment to the test! In this 2v2v2 scramble, one team uses premium clubs, another gets decent budget gear, and the last is stuck with complete junk. If you’ve ever wondered how much gear truly matters, this video’s got you covered!

Expect some laughs mixed with insightful moments about golf gear and performance.

9. Can I Beat Tommy Fleetwood If I Start 5 Under Par?

Channel: Grant Horvat
Views: 1.4 million

In a fun twist, Grant challenges himself to see if he can best Tommy Fleetwood, even after starting 5 under par. With some hilarious commentary from Caddy Mike and plenty of skilled golf action, this video showcases the energy between pro talent and emerging YouTube stars.

You won’t want to miss this high-energy match-up!

10. The Bob Does Sports X Grant Horvat X Bryan Bros Match Of A Lifetime

Channel: Bob Does Sports
Views: 1 million

To wrap it up, the fantastic Bob Does Sports teams up with Wesley Bryan and Fat Perez for a thrilling 3v3 scramble against George Bryan, Joey Dart, and Grant Horvat. This match is a wonderful combo of competitive spirit and sheer hilarity, delivering what you would expect from this eclectic crew.

It’s the perfect finale to our top 10 countdown!


So, there you have it! June brought us a fantastic array of golf content that’s just too enjoyable to miss. Whether you’re into serious challenges, comedic twists, or high-stakes matches, this month’s offerings have something for everyone. Don’t forget to check out these videos, and let the good times roll on the greens!
